site stats

Git pull - force

WebJul 13, 2009 · First, update all origin/ refs to latest:. git fetch --all Backup your current branch (e.g. master): git branch backup-master Jump to the latest commit on origin/master and checkout those files:. git reset --hard origin/master WebJul 21, 2014 · Even remote branches have a copy on the local. There's only a bit of metadata that tells git that a specific local copy is actually a remote branch. In git, all files are on your hard disk all the time. If you don't have any branches other than master, you should: git checkout -b 'temp' git branch -D master git checkout master git branch -D temp

Git: force a pull to overwrite local changes - Stack Overflow

WebSteps to forcing git pull to override local files. Fetching branches. Resetting changes. Maintaining current local commits. Uncommitted changes. Using git pull. Related Resources. You may encounter a conflict issue when several users are working on the same files. There are cases when you want to force pull to overwrite the local changes from ... WebI recently updated my local Git installation to 1.8.1 from 1.8.0.1. I'm noticing that, when I work on GitHub, it doesn't prompt me for username and password on push anymore. This troubles me, as I see having to type user and password every time as … channel rules twitch https://oceanbeachs.com

git pull and resolve conflicts - Stack Overflow

WebApr 13, 2024 · abc_normal.git $ git show $ {file_or_commit_hash} abc_mirror.git $ git show $ {file_or_commit_hash} fatal: bad object $ {file_hash} I am able to see some files using the same commands above in both mirror and normal repo. I thought I'd be able to see all the commits and file hashes in the mirror repo as well as the normal ... WebJun 20, 2024 · There is a workaround to do a forced push on Github Desktop (Tested on Github Desktop for Mac, and for Windows) STEP-1: Switch to history, tab. STEP-2: Then click and drag one commit over the other. Squash commit popup will come, choose accordingly. STEP-3: Now you will be able to see force push. WebAug 3, 2013 · 73. When you push to a remote and you use the --set-upstream flag git sets the branch you are pushing to as the remote tracking branch of the branch you are pushing. Adding a remote tracking branch means that git then knows what you want to do when you git fetch, git pull or git push in future. It assumes that you want to keep the local branch ... harley street psychiatrist adhd

Git: pull with merge - Stack Overflow

Category:django - git pull, don

Tags:Git pull - force

Git pull - force

GitHub - amitlevy/BFGPT: Brute Force GPT is an experiment to …

WebNov 4, 2015 · $ git push -f は存在するが。 $ git pull -f は存在しない。 かわりに以下のようにすれば良い。 $ git fetch $ git reset --hard origin/branch_name. エイリアス登録. し …

Git pull - force

Did you know?

WebApr 18, 2014 · Add a comment. 1. Pull is primarily a nice interface around fetch and associated commends such as sync and reset. To get the behaviour you want we have to drop down to the level below. As such try this to fetch and then clobber your working copy: git fetch origin master git reset --hard FETCH_HEAD git clean -df. Share. WebJul 24, 2024 · In this situation, if you try to force merge by following commands, git pull origin master --allow-unrelated-histories. git merge origin origin/master. It will create a lot of conflicts, as it is not able to find the history of …

WebJan 10, 2024 · git checkout -b "branch-to-save-my-two-commits" : This will cause git to move the working directory to a branch with that name. It will not commit, you have to do that by yourself. git pull origin master --force: Will cause to force pull from master (like what it sounds like). I think, it would override all local changes on the actual master ... WebApr 7, 2024 · How do I force "git pull" to overwrite local files? 8329. How do I check out a remote Git branch? 20038. How do I delete a Git branch locally and remotely? 5862. How do I change the URI (URL) for a remote Git repository? 7613. How do I revert a Git repository to a previous commit? 11181.

WebJul 10, 2024 · Note that neither git pull --recurse-submodules nor git submodule update --recursive does not initialize newly added submodules. To initialize them you need run git submodule update --recursive --init.Quote from manual: If the submodule is not yet initialized, and you just want to use the setting as stored in .gitmodules, you can … Webgit pull --force. Now you must be thinking, what is git pull --force then? it feels like it would help to overwrite local changes. instead, it fetches forcefully but does not merge …

WebGitTip: See the difference between Git pull and Git fetch and understand how each command works. What about git pull --force? While it might seem that this command would result in a Git pull force, adding the - …

Webreza.cse08. 5,892 47 39. Add a comment. 3. To exclude a folder from git across all projects on your machine, you can use core.excludesfile configuration Git documentation. Create a file called ~/.gitignore_global then add files or folders you would like to exclude like node_modules or editor folders like .vscode. channel rush liveWebNov 29, 2011 · 2. You have to commit your changes after you resolve the conflicts and push them back. Usually instead of using git pull I do a git fetch followed by a git merge and then git commit. This will only fetch the upstream changes, allow you manually merge and resolve conflicts, then commit them locally. When you're ready push the changes back to ... harley street psychiatryWebSo you want to git force pull. For the Googlers: there’s no such thing as `git force pull` -- instead, you want to run these two commands: git stash git pull. Together, these … channel rubber cable protectorWebForce git pull to Overwrite Local Files. If you have made commits locally that you regret, you may want your local branch to match the remote branch without saving any of your work. This can be done using git reset. First, … channel safety \u0026 marine supply incWebJan 27, 2016 · 8. One (simple*) way to handle this without branching or stashing: stage/commit your changes locally. pull remote. at this point you'll be notified of any merge conflicts. If git cannot automatically resolve merge conflicts, it will open the two versions in whatever editor you have set up as your default merge editor. harley street psychiatrists londonWebApr 24, 2016 · I tried to repair the merge with Git merge errors.One set of errors turns into another set of errors, ad infinitum.I also tried resetting the problem file according to Ignore files during merge with plans to copy/paste the one line needed, but the broken index persists.. This has turned into a complete waste of time, and I am no longer interested in … channels 6 news 7 30 2019 chleft lipWebThe target branch is the anonymous branch, and the merge-from branch is your original (pre-rebase) branch: so "--ours" means the anonymous one rebase is building while "--theirs" means "our branch being rebased". As for the gitattributes entry: it could have an effect: "ours" really means "use stage #2" internally. channels 0 clahe.apply channels 0